Let’s move on to the making of these delicious Christmas Cookies!
What do we need: (I can’t really tell you how many cookies you’ll get because every cookie cutter is different in size. I had about 90 little cookies)
- 250 g flour
- 160 g butter at room temperature
- 20 g vanilla sugar
- 100 g powder sugar
- 1 egg yolk
- a pinch of salt
- a little bit sugar
- a bowl
- cookie cutters
- baking paper
- baking tray
How to:
Mix together the flour, vanilla sugar, powder sugar and the salt in a bowl.
Cut the butter in small pieces and add them to the dry ingredients.
Start moulding the ingredients until they form a solid dough.
Once you’ve got that solid dough, put it on your table and mould it into a ball.
Wrap the ball of dough in cling wrap and put it in the fridge for one hour.
In the meantime you can watch some series or search your cookie cutters…
Preheat the oven at 180°C.
Put some baking paper on your tray.
Roll out the dough until it’s about 5 to 10 mm thick.
Cut out some fun figures and place them on your baking tray.
Beat the egg yolk. Spread some of the egg yolk on your cookies.
Sprinkle some sugar over your Christmas Cookies.
Bake them for about 20 minutes.
After 20 minutes:
Let the cookies cool before serving or packing them.
